This project investigates the sources and atmospheric processing of carbonaceous aerosols in East Asia, particularly from residential and industrial combustion. It aims to quantify contributions from various sources to better understand their impact on climate and air quality.
High loading of carbonaceous aerosols from residential combustion of coal and wood fuels, traffic, industry, and biomass burning pollute the air of East Asia.
The resulting Atmospheric Brown Clouds (ABC) are in wintertime warming the atmosphere yet dimming the surface in this vast region with severe impact on the climate, food and water security as well as air quality.
